The Abu Dhabi Police GHQ, represented by the Medical Services Administration organizes the fourth Musculoskeletal Ultrasound Meeting during the period from 17-19 September 2011 at Fairmont Hotel in Abu Dhabi.
The organizing committee announced that registration will be through: www.adpus.ae The meeting targets radiologists, orthopedists, sport medicine physicians and surgeons, Physiotherapy & Rehabilitation Professionals, rheumatologists, anesthetists, vascular surgeons, and emergency doctors.
According to Dr.Ayman Fahim, the Course Director, the meeting addresses the diagnostic use of ultrasound in detection and treatment of musculoskeletal disorders. It will include two simultaneous courses; the third Basic Course and the First Intermediate Course. Both courses contain lecture sessions together with Demo and Hands On training instructed by High Caliber Faculty of international experts representing different medical schools.
The Abu Dhabi Police Medical Services Administration aims to be a local, regional and International training center for such kind of courses.
Being a relatively recent procedure in the Musculoskeletal field, the use of ultrasound saves a lot of time for diagnosing a variety of conditions apart from its advantages in using guided therapeutic injections that may save some cases from being exposed to surgery.
